I had this diffuser on my E55 last year. There's no way it will ever stay on with just 3M double tape. You do have to remove the OEM plastic piece, than use some tape and screws. You must drill into the lower bumper and attached with screws.. There were a few guys including myself who installed these, and they all needed screws.
